Sagar (Madhya Pradesh): Collector Sandeep GR has registered an FIR against more than 48 people and imposed a fine of Rs 1.85 lakh on them for burning stubble.
The collector directed all sub-divisional magistrates and Tehsildars to act against people burning stubble.
The collector said the officials had registered more than 54 FIRs against the guilty.
Sub-divisional magistrate of Bina, Vijay Dehria, registered the higher number of FIRs (nine), the collector said.
According to the collector, Dehria imposed a fine of Rs 96,500 on the defaulters.
Steps to stop child marriages
Collector Sandeep GR has directed the members of the flying squad to stop child marriages.
The administration will act against the people organising child marriages on April 30, when people also organise child marriages, the collector said.
The caterers and photographers should take the birth certificates of the boys and girls getting married from their parents.
If such people violate the instructions, they will also face action, he said.
He said the public representatives and the private institutions should take the copies of the birth certificates, mark sheets and school transfer certificates of the boys and girls getting married.
